The new student orientation program at Clemson University is the first step in ensuring that new undergraduate students have a successful transition and integration into college life. The program promotes discussion among parents, new students, continuing students, and faculty and staff on the expectations and perceptions of the campus community.

The last step in signing up for Orientation will be to pay the Student Transitions and Support fee of $250. This fee funds a variety of programs and services in addition to spring Orientation such as academic advising, on-going transition activities, family programming, and retention initiatives. It supports the success of students during their entire time at Clemson University.
